What are the benefits of using large glazed ceramic planters outdoors?
Glazed ceramic planters offer several advantages for outdoor use. The glaze provides a protective layer against the elements, preventing water damage and making them more resistant to cracking than unglazed terracotta. Their weight also helps to stabilize larger plants, preventing them from tipping over in windy conditions. Furthermore, the variety of colors and finishes available allows for seamless integration into any garden design aesthetic, from modern minimalist to rustic charm. Finally, ceramic's ability to retain moisture can benefit plants, reducing the frequency of watering, especially in drier climates.

How do I choose the right size planter for my plants?
Choosing the right size planter is critical for the health and growth of your plants. The general rule is to select a planter that is at least 1-2 inches larger in diameter than the root ball of your plant. Larger plants, like trees or shrubs, will obviously require significantly larger planters. Consider the mature size of your plant – you don't want to constantly repot it as it grows. Remember to account for the depth of the planter as well, ensuring it provides ample space for root development and drainage.
Are glazed ceramic planters frost-resistant?
While glazed ceramic offers some protection, the extent of frost resistance depends on several factors, including the type of clay used, the thickness of the ceramic, and the presence of any added frost-resistant additives during manufacturing. It's wise to research the specific planter’s frost resistance or consider protecting them during harsh winters by moving them to a sheltered area or wrapping them in insulation.
How do I care for large glazed ceramic planters?
Caring for your glazed ceramic planters is relatively straightforward. Regular cleaning with mild soap and water can remove dirt and grime.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ners that can damage the glaze. For winter storage, ensure the planters are completely dry before storing them in a sheltered place to prevent cracking due to freezing temperatures.
